POSITION TITLE: Substitute Paraeducator- on call/as needed
LOCATION: Coupeville School District - Building: TBD
JOB NUMBER: 787
Rate of Pay: $21.38
All employed substitute paraeducators must be 1) at least eighteen years of age and 2) hold a high school diploma or its equivalent. In addition, a paraeducator 3) must meetone of the following:
Fingerprints: Pass a Washington State Patrol & FBI fingerprint background check. (Estimated fee is $104, applicant paid. Fingerprints may be scheduled at the ESD 189 in Anacortes. ESD 189 - https://www.nwesd.org/fingerprinting/ )
